**Job Description**:
We have a permanent opportunity to join our IT Projects group to support the delivery of Defence programs. Including the direct support the start-up of the first phase of a new multi-year program, which will expand the capacity of the large enterprise environment for the next step of the program.
Your accountabilities will include:
- developing technical documentation format that is compliant to contractual agreements.
- standardising and editing technical documentation prepared by managers, engineers, architects and other technical team members.
- ensuring materials are organised and completed within identified timeframes in accordance with defined standards regarding order, clarity, conciseness, style and terminology.
- conducting technical document content verification activities including desktop analysis and participation during tests.
- creating and maintaining technical meeting minutes.
- Assisting in the development of in house and project documentation.
**Qualifications**:
You'll have excellent communication (verbal and written) and interpersonal skills along with good time management, planning and organising skills. You are analytically minded with strong problem-solving skills and hold a high level of initiative and self-motivation. You'll also have:
- significant experience in technical writing within a large, complex environment
- good knowledge across broad array of technology and domains
- High level proficiency in Microsoft office suite
- Experience with IT Service Desks, IT Service Management and IT Support
